Hello there simplicity
From as far back as the 1960s much focus was positioned on vibrant colour in the restroom. Patterned wall surface ceramic tiles of maritime creatures and also excessive colours were the trend, along with plastic. Plastic shower room design was the craze, from vibrant orange, olive eco-friendly, mustard yellow and chocolate brownish coloured toothbrush, soap and towel owners, to thick patterned plastic shower drapes that shrieked colours of the boldest nature.
As the times went on, the 1970s as well as very early 1980s ended up being a period when gold washroom mendings and providing, such as taps, towel rails and also toilet roll holders, were taken into consideration extremely stylish. These over the top gold trimmed attributes were popular, and also shower room décor was 'loud'. Contributed to this were those once fascinating bathroom collections in colours avocado, reefs pink, and delicious chocolate brown. Shower room colour has altered significantly over the past decade, and also shades have actually become a lot more neutral, sometimes with a hint of colour that includes a complementary vigour to the overall plan.
Of the many hundreds of people that took part in Plumbworld's current bathroom survey, a frustrating 82 per cent stated they "despised" the as soon as glorified avocado as well as reefs pink restroom collections, colours residue of 1970s and 1980s, which are normally qualified as being dark and boring.
According to the study, chrome bathroom faucets were much chosen to gold.
So, when creating and embellishing your shower room maintain those dark colours at bay, think about white suites, and also opt for chrome mendings and also home furnishings instead of fancy gold.
Shower power
When preparing the layout of your bathroom, one of one of the most crucial facets to consider is putting a shower. Some shower rooms do not have ample room to consist of a shower cubicle, so evaluate your choices. Think about mounting a shower over the bathroom if space is limited.
The survey showed that 94 per cent of its individuals thought that a shower in a washroom was really important, and 81 per cent stated they chose a different shower room in a huge washroom. Virtually 65 percent claimed their suitable would certainly be a power shower, while 27 per cent chosen mixer showers, and only 12 per cent opted for electrical showers.
If you have actually selected a shower over the bath, then think about placing a fixed glass display as opposed to a shower drape. It may cost a few added pounds, yet over half of the survey's contributors preferred a set glass display to a shower curtain.
Choosing your bath tub
Unlike typical belief, adding a whirlpool bath to raise residential property value doesn't constantly work. So if you're considering selling your property, attempt to prevent purchasing a whirlpool bath in the hopes of obtaining extra profit.
The study disclosed that near to 53 per cent of its individuals were not phased by them, while only a tiny 38 percent of individuals "liked" them. Surprisingly, 62 percent claimed they had "no solid view" towards edge bathrooms either, which implies the conventional rectangle-shaped bathrooms still hold influence against their beautified counter components.
Restroom flooring
Attempt to prevent the urge to place carpetings on the bathroom flooring, according to the study it is not too favoured. The study revealed that the preferred floor covering was floor tiles, with 75 per cent saying they "enjoyed" a tiled shower room floor. Popular plastic flooring has not yet shed its location in the bathroom, with greater than 61 per cent saying they really did not have any type of solid sort or dislikes in the direction of it.
When selecting your bathroom floor covering, ceramic tiles is the favoured alternative, however if the budget is limited, then plastic floor covering will not let you down.
In addition to the flooring, see to it your windows look appealing. When it involves dressing your bathroom home windows, steer clear of those shower room webs and textile curtains. The study showed that 94 percent said they favoured blinds in the washroom to curtains.

How To Design Small Bathrooms
few months ago I wrote a blog on how to design a general perfect bathroom. So continuing from that let’s have a look now on how to design small bathrooms. As let’s be honest here, how many of you have got a big or a good size bathroom in your home? Well, I guess not many, and as matter of fact, many of the bathrooms in an average house are quite small. When we design our client’ bathrooms we always find many challenges to take in consideration and issue to solve. So let’s consider some design tips that can help you to make the most of your space without compromising on the essential but still give the illusion of spaciousness!
The secret of how to design small bathroom is all in the planning, and the smallest space the more this needs to be well thought. Hence prioritise what is most important to you. Don’t forget about the negative space that you need around you in order to move and not having to hit another piece of furniture or object. That will hand up in screaming and frustration every time that you will use the bathroom! So consider well where you are going to position your basin, toilet and bath or shower and think that with these will follow also accessories and they need to be taken into consideration in terms of space too.
Tiles, units & brassware
Be smart when you choose your tiles. Try and select large, plain tiles for the wall for instance with a different colour version of the flooring. If you can, avoid too many patterns. If you do choose patterns do only or for the walls or the floor and not both as this will make the space feel cramped.
Try and clear the floor as much as you can. Therefore, if you want to make the room feel bigger opt for wall-mounted units. These are handy also when it comes to cleaning – always think at the practical side too!
Also, choosing the right brassware can make a difference in terms of spatial illusion. In fact, wall-mounted taps and shower mixer with a concealed body are a nice way for reducing the visual clutter and making the space feel larger.
Storage
Always a big issue when it comes to bathroom and one aspect that people often forget. You look at the beautiful pictures on Pinterest or magazine where there is just one small bottle on display. In reality, doesn’t really work like this. You all are going to have toilet paper packs, shower gel, soap bottles and a lot of more stuff that you need for your everyday use. Thus when planning your bathroom think form the start how you can create the extra space and plan ahead for fitted niches or conceal cupboards withing stud walls. Also try and get vanity unit with drawers or cabinet that are quite spacious where you can put things and not only look pretty!
When it comes to heating underfloor heating is a good solution and space efficient. Or use towel rails, which can also be used for heating too.
If you are a bath person and not having the right space for a full-size tub why don’t consider Bijou style baths that usually are smaller in length and also so pretty!
When it comes to saving space people don’t consider doors. Using sliding or pocket doors can be a good free up layout option. Or if you still want to keep the standard door, then make sure that you hang it so the swing is outside the room!
Last but not least don’t forget of course to add a good size mirror. This is the most simple trick for creating the illusion of more space and also can help to spread the lights around.
